TABLE 5-9
A major hotel chain keeps a record of the number of mishandled bags per 1,000 customers. In a recent year, the hotel chain had 4.06 mishandled bags per 1,000 customers. Assume that the number of mishandled bags has a Poisson distribution.
-Referring to Table 5-9, what is the probability that in the next 1,000 customers, the hotel chain will have no more than two and at least eight mishandled bags?

Nonstore Retailing

Selling goods or services outside of a traditional retail establishment, such as online, direct mail, or telemarketing.

Direct Selling

A retail channel where sales are made directly to consumers, bypassing traditional retail environments.

Vending Machines

Automated machines that provide items such as snacks, beverages, and other products to consumers after money, a credit card, or a specially designed card is inserted into the machine.
